This adds two changes: - Isolates pre-push hook dependencies into an isolated venv, no longer affect your system environment - Lets you manually run the pre-push lintrunner (including with lintrunner -a) by invoking `python scripts/lintrunner.py [-a]` (it's ugly, but better than nothing...for now) This is a follow up to: - https://github.com/pytorch/pytorch/pull/158389 ## Problem The current pre-push hook setup installs lintrunner and related dependencies globally, which makes developers nervous about system pollution and can cause version conflicts with existing installations. Also, if the pre-push lintrunner found errors, you had to hope your normal lintrunner could fix them (which wasn't always the case, e.g. if those errors only manifested in certain python versions) ## Key Changes: - Isolated Environment: Creates .git/hooks/linter/.venv/ with Python 3.9 (the python used in CI) and an isolated lintrunner installation - User-Friendly CLI: New python scripts/lintrunner.py wrapper allows developers to run lintrunner (including -a auto-fix) from any environment - Simplified Architecture: Eliminates pre-commit dependency entirely - uses direct git hooks File Changes: - scripts/setup_hooks.py: Rewritten to create isolated uv-managed virtual environment - scripts/lintrunner.py: New wrapper script with shared hash management logic - scripts/run_lintrunner.py: Removed (functionality merged into lintrunner.py) - .pre-commit-config.yaml: Removed (no longer needed) ## Usage: ``` # Setup (run once) python scripts/setup_hooks.py # Manual linting (works from any environment) python scripts/lintrunner.py # Check mode python scripts/lintrunner.py -a # Auto-fix mode # Git hooks work automatically git push # Runs lintrunner in isolated environment # Need to skip the pre-push hook? git push --no-verify ``` ## Benefits: - ✅ Zero global dependency installation - ✅ Per-repository isolation prevents version conflicts - ✅ Full lintrunner functionality is now accessible ## Implementation Notes: - Virtual env is kept in a dedicated dir in .git, to keep per-repo mechanics - lintrunner.py does not need to be invoked from a specific venv. It'll invoke the right venv itself. A minor bug: It tends to garble the lintrunner output a bit, like the screenshot below shows, but I haven't found a workaround so far and it remains understandable to users: <img width="241" height="154" alt="image" src="https://github.com/user-attachments/assets/9496f925-8524-4434-8486-dc579442d688" /> ## What's next? Features that could be added: - Check for lintrunner updates, auto-update if needed - Depending on dev response, this could be enabled by default for all pytorch/pytorch environments Pull Request resolved: https://github.com/pytorch/pytorch/pull/160048 Approved by: https://github.com/seemethere
